#1
Wary Hearts
1988
Amidst the treacherous intrigues of the English court, their passion raged like wildfire... She was a maiden pledged to the holy church, until one man aroused her to love... Shy and lovely Nessa had vowed to be a nun, unlike her worldly sister, the beauteous, selfish Aleria. Yet when Garrick, Earl of Tarrant, arrived at Salisbury to claim the bride bestowed upon him by King Henry, Nessa felt a surge of unaccustomed emotion. Garrick, a man distrustful of the fairer sex, was to wed her sister...but Nessa herself was deeply attracted to the brooding, dashing nobleman. Great was Garrick's disappointment to find himself bethrothed to the vainglorious Aleria. Only he divined the sensual fire beneath Nessa's quiet demeanor...yet even he could not know how fervently she longed to return his passion. Joined in uneasy wedlock by a clever intrigue of Queen Eleanor, they dared not trust the love that was now their right. But when Garrick was threatened by a dastardly foe, Nessa would summon all her womanly arts to win his heart and his trust...and to save his very life!
#3
Proud Hearts
1990
In a land besieged by war, they were sworn enemies—destined for a golden, glorious love... Honor bade him give her up for ransom...but her love would prove the greatest treasure of all... Sir William of Kensham stormed into the crude hut that was Cassandra Gavre's prison, furious that his men had defied orders to kill all Frenchmen who invaded the forests of the Weald—and only slightly mollified to find that his captive was the lovely young daughter of a French lord. The lavender-eyed beauty's ransom would aid King Henry's cause, and William prayed it would be accomplished quickly, having no liking for the company of haughty highborn ladies. Yet Cassandra was no coy, spoiled maiden. Frightened yet fascinated by her handsome, notorious captor, she met his gaze unflinchingly...filling him with a longing it was torment to deny. And when at last they joined in mutual surrender, claiming a desperate, forbidden ecstasy, William swore that he would never give up the bold, passionate woman who was fated to be his bride...
